Board Member
Fiona's interest in the Society began at a planting event at Ohinetahi Bush some months following the 2017 Port Hills fire. She continues to participate in habitat restoration activities undertaken by Society volunteers, and enjoys the sense of purpose and achievement these activities provide.
This involvement has strengthened her appreciation of the Port Hills and she especially enjoys the sense of remoteness in those areas accessible only by foot or bike.
Fiona brings her experience with a similar group and employment in local government planning and policy development to the Board.
